From b8e9549304761b624e1b92c1245054a960c6297b Mon Sep 17 00:00:00 2001 From: Pinapelz Date: Wed, 12 Nov 2025 19:54:51 -0800 Subject: add confirmation before downloading for duplicate urls checks the output dir to see if there is already a file with that videoId if it is, then show a confirmation prompt --- src/main/java/FileUtility.java | 13 +++++++++++++ 1 file changed, 13 insertions(+) (limited to 'src/main/java/FileUtility.java') diff --git a/src/main/java/FileUtility.java b/src/main/java/FileUtility.java index 1c532e4..936cecd 100644 --- a/src/main/java/FileUtility.java +++ b/src/main/java/FileUtility.java @@ -84,6 +84,19 @@ public class FileUtility { return null; } + public static boolean findFileContainingString(String directory, String searchString){ + File dir = new File(directory); + File[] files = dir.listFiles(); + assert files != null; + for(File file : files){ + if(file.getName().contains(searchString)){ + return true; + } + } + return false; + } + + public static String findJsonFile(String folderName) { File folder = new File(folderName); File[] listOfFiles = folder.listFiles(); -- cgit v1.2.3